Machine and process control systems require that programmable controllers be interconnected, so that data can be passed among them easily to accomplish the control task. Learners will contrast Programmable Logic Controllers (PLC), Programmable Automation Controllers (PAC) and Personal Computer (PC) programming environments. Typically PLCs are suited for machine control, PACs are bettered suited for complex automation and the PC programming environment offers purpose-built Industrial PCs for manufacturing flexibility. Provides an in-depth study of precision agriculture systems, data management tools, and site-specific crop management strategies. Learners examine the operation and accuracy of GPS/GNSS systems, yield monitors, grid and zone soil sampling, remote sensing technologies, and autosteer guidance and implement rate control systems. Students analyze agronomic data, interpret aerial imagery, create management zones, and develop variable-rate prescriptions using precision agriculture software. Hands-on lab work supports skill development in equipment operation, software use, and data interpretation for modern agronomic practices.

Explore the foundational principles of constitutional law as they apply to the criminal justice system. Students will examine the structure of the U.S. court system and the development of case law that shapes modern legal practices. The course will focus on the constitutional amendments most relevant to law enforcement, including the 4th, 5th, 6th, and 14th Amendments, and their implications for search and seizure procedures, the use of force, the rules of evidence, and the conduct of interviews and interrogations.
